Flat 7, 14 Harmer Street, Gravesend, DA12 2AX is a leasehold flat built before 1900. The property offers approximately 517 square feet of living space and is situated on the 3rd floor. In this location, apartments of similar size usually have one bedroom.

The estimated current market value of the property is £121,216 , which equates to approximately £235 per square foot. It was last sold on 5 Mar 2004 for £75,000. Since then, the value has increased by £46,216, representing a 61.6% increase, or approximately 2.8% per year.

The current estimated value of £121,216 is:

  • 35.9% lower than the average property price on Harmer Street
  • 54.8% lower than the average in the DA12 2AX postcode area
  • and 64.6% lower than the average price for Gravesend as a whole

Flat 7, 14 Harmer Street, Gravesend, Gravesham, Kent, DA12 2AX has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of D, based on the latest assessment carried out on 30 Jan 2020.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from main heating system. The windows are single gl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 20 Apr 2009, when the property was rated C. The current rating of D reflects a decline in energy efficiency of 10.8%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The main heating energy efficiency changing from very good to good, while the heating system type remained the same (boiler and radiators, mains gas).
  • The roof construction or insulation changed from pitched, 50mm loft insulation to pitched, 50 mm loft insulation, with no change in energy efficiency (poor).
  • The lighting was updated from no low energy lighting to low energy lighting in 80% of fixed outlets, with efficiency improving from very poor to very good.
